AWS Lambda の Scheduled Event を試してみた #reinvent

104件のシェア(ちょっぴり話題の記事)

この記事は公開されてから1年以上経過しています。情報が古い可能性がありますので、ご注意ください。

遂に来た!スケジュールイベント

待ちに待った Lambda のスケジュールイベントが出ました!今日から使えます。バッチ処理とかいろいろ夢広がりますね。早速試してみました!

Lambda function に設定してみる

Lambda ファンクションを適当に作成し、Add event source の中に…

lambda-schedule01

きたー!

lambda-schedule03

Scheduled expression というところで、イベントを発生させる周期を選べます。デフォルトは5分。

lambda-schedule02

5分、15分、1時間、1日、cron 形式から選べます。cron 形式による指定であれば、平日のみとか深夜だけとか自由自在にカスタマイズ可能です。

lambda-schedule04

完成したら Submit します。作成後はこんな感じです。

lambda-schedule05

CloudWatch で見てみました。5分おきに Invoke されています!(試行回数が少ないのはご容赦くださいw)

lambda-schedule06

まとめ

Scheduled Event の登場で、Lambda を利用する機会がさらに多くなると思います。活用していきましょう!!